New Laconia is back louder, heavier, and more cinematic than ever, with โCaptain Daredevil,โ the newest chapter in their sprawling sci-fi saga that has become one of the most creatively ambitious music storylines in todayโs metal underground.
Following the jazz-fusion world-building of New Laconia, this single slams the narrative into high-velocity combat mode, swapping hazy planetary dreamscapes for steel-clad riffs, star-pirate standoffs, and pure adrenaline.
The storyline picks up immediately where the previous track left off, when the Bear-Bartender escapes a deadly ambush but loses his ship to space pirates. With no vessel and no choice, he and the Engineer summon a legendary mercenary, Captain Daredevil, a bounty hunter feared and revered across galaxies. With this action movie urgency, the band seems to be building their own universe.
It hits like a meteor, too, because the track tears open with grinding, deep guitars slicing into wide-shouldered riffs that feel like engines roaring to life under a crimson war-sky. Steady, hard-thumping drums keep the song marching forward like troops gearing up for battle, refusing to let the energy dip for even a moment. Over this heavy artillery, the vocals fire with energetic, virulent intensity, with ripping cries.
Where some bands release songs, New Laconia releases chapters. โCaptain Daredevilโ is a cinematic continuation of a universe in motion, showing that music can tell stories as epic as any film. Strap in, hit play, and follow the Bear into battle, because the New Laconia saga is only just beginning.
